草庐IT

java - 如何从 Java 应用程序连接到在线 MySQL 数据库

为了一项作业,我正在开发一个需要在MySQL数据库中执行插入操作的应用程序。我正在使用JDBC,但我拥有的托管服务不支持JDBC。我能做什么?这个方法是不是太老了?您能否建议我从Java应用程序基本上插入远程MySQL数据库的任何替代方法?编辑:我想知道为什么人们花时间以无用的方式编辑旧问题......你真的在乎我写的是mysql还是MySQL?对我来说没有意义,你可以花时间实际回答问题...... 最佳答案 不,这并不老,为了使用java连接到数据库,您需要有JDBC!为了做到这一点,开始一个简单的JSP概念验证,您可能会看到它起

mysql - 在mysql中创建一个表作为另一个表

我正在尝试创建一个表(即test1)作为另一个表(test2)。test2有所有记录。有一些重复的记录如下:现在我想在表test1中记录表test2的所有记录,如下所示(使用创建命令):提前致谢 最佳答案 对于MySQL,您可能可以这样尝试:INSERTINTOtest1(id,name,address,mobile,genere)SELECTid,name,address,mobile,genereFROMtest2GROUPBYname,address,mobile,genere或者如果你想要一个CREATE语法试试CREATE

mysql - 玩Scala Anorm一对多关系

来自playanorm,createamodelfromjsonwithoutpassinganormPKvalueinthejson我正在尝试将Seq[Address]添加到案例类中,例如caseclassUser(id:Pk[Long]=NotAssigned,name:String="",email:String="",addresses:Seq[Address])Address是一个包含三个字符串的简单对象/类。一个用户可以有多个地址,我如何在findAll中获取所有地址以及用户。deffindAll():Seq[User]={Logger.info("select*fromp

php - 如何在 mysql 中确定 OR 条件的优先级

我有这样的表结构+---+----------+-----------+--------------+|id|customer|Address|Address_type|+---+----------+-----------+--------------+|1|1|Address1|2||2|2|Address2|2||3|1|Address3|1|+---+----------+-----------+--------------+数据库中有两种地址类型。我必须根据以下条件选择地址如果存在Address_type=1的客户地址,则显示该地址。如果Address_type=1不存在而A

php - 填充第三个表以保持效率

我目前正在为一个PHP/MySQL项目工作。在完成作业时研究数据库的高效设计时,我注意到在许多情况下,在仅处理两组数据时创建第三个表是一种很好的做法。例如,如果我们有一张“学生”表和一张“地址”表,创建第三张表似乎是个好主意,即“Student_Addresses”,因为假设一个学生可以有多个地址(分开parent等),一个地址可以代表多个学生(sibling)。我的问题是:我们如何着手填充第三个表?有没有一种方法可以使用主键和/或外键自动完成?我试过谷歌和我的教科书来理解这一点,但我一无所获。非常感谢指向教程或文章的链接。感谢您的帮助。我希望问题和例子很清楚。

php - 存储单个 IP、IP 范围、IP block 和 IP 类别并快速搜索它们的最佳方式

在MySQL数据库中存储多种IP类型的最佳方式是什么:-单一IP(123.123.123.123)-IP范围(123.123.123.1-123.123.123.121)-IPblock(123.123.123.1/20)-IP类(123.123.123.*或123.123..)我正在考虑将所有范围/block/类转换为单个IP,并使用ip2long存储它们以便更快地搜索到表中,但这将导致超过100万个数据库,我也需要不时减少/扩大类或更改/删除IPblock。每次有人访问我的网站时都会访问此数据库(因此需要快速)。有什么想法吗? 最佳答案

mysql - 每行的动态数据透视表(MySql)

我有一张顾客喜欢的table:IDTypeDateAddressSSNRT124MASTER12/15/20057Hillst12345RT542MASTER06/14/20067Hillst12345HT457UNIQUE10/27/200910PARKWAY24569QA987UNIQUE08/28/201010PARKWAY24569AH825UNIQUE10/12/201210PARKWAY2456914837SINGLE05/05/20102TEDROAD1111124579MARRIED06/24/20142TEDROAD11111我想要的是为每个重复的地址和SSN创建一个

mysql - 员工详细信息及其工作类型

我有一个包含以下表格的数据库:createtableEMPLOYEE(Emp_IDINTNOTNULLAUTO_INCREMENT,Emp_FNameVARCHAR(30)NOTNULL,Emp_LNameVARCHAR(30)NOTNULL,Address_ID_ResidentINTREFERENCESADDRESS(Address_ID),JobTime_IDCHAR(1)REFERENCESJOBTIME(JobTime_ID),PRIMARYKEY(Emp_ID));其他表地址如下:createtableADDRESS(Address_IDINTNOTNULLAUTO_INC

mysql服务没有启动:Address already in use

关闭。这个问题是off-topic.它目前不接受答案。想改进这个问题吗?Updatethequestion所以它是on-topic用于堆栈溢出。关闭9年前。Improvethisquestion我正在尝试在ubuntu上安装mysql-5.5.29源代码。每次我重新启动或启动服务时,它都告诉我MySQLDaemon启动失败..shell>>servicemysql.serverstartStartingMySQL...*TheserverquitwithoutupdatingPIDfile(/usr/local/mysql/data/ytl-HP-Pavilion-g4-Noteboo

MySQL 守护进程拒绝以 "Can' 启动服务器 : Bind on TCP/IP port: Address already in use"(it's not).

关闭。这个问题不符合StackOverflowguidelines.它目前不接受答案。这个问题似乎不是关于aspecificprogrammingproblem,asoftwarealgorithm,orsoftwaretoolsprimarilyusedbyprogrammers的.如果您认为这个问题是关于anotherStackExchangesite的主题,您可以发表评论,说明问题可能在哪里得到解答。关闭9年前。Improvethisquestion好吧,伙计们,我已经准备好放弃这件事了,我想我快到了,只是最后一个错误,服务器启动正常,但随后它无法说明TCP/IP上的绑定(bin